What is architecture and interior design?
Basic requirements that they focus on: Architects focus on more technical aspects like a form of a building, direction, materials, etc. An interior designer focuses more on aspects like human wants and needs, the functionality of the space, and aesthetics.
What is the difference between architecture and interior architecture?
In simple terms, interior architecture is a combination of interior design and architecture. Whilst an architect looks to design the framework of a building, and also advise in its construction, an interior architect looks to update an interior by reconstructing or reshaping a space.
What is included in interior architecture?
Interior architecture is a practice that incorporates the art of design and the science of architecture, and it focuses on the technical aspects of planning and building a room. This field involves making the room safe and functional as well as designing aesthetically-appealing lighting, color, and texture for a space.
